Job Details
Responsibilities:
1. Oversee all aspects of commercial construction projects from planning to implementation.
2. Allocate resources for assigned projects.
3. Supervise onsite personnel and subcontractors.
4. Interface with project inspectors, contractors, architects, engineers, city and county officials, and clients.
5. Maintain high standards of workmanship that adhere to original plans and specifications.
6. Ensure project documents are complete, current, and stored appropriately.
7. Conduct quality control duties and responsibilities regarding the work being performed.
8. Communicate with project team regarding ASI’s, RFI’s, and Material Submittals.
9. Regularly inspect the work of subcontractors to ensure quality and conformity with plans.
10. Ensure all onsite personnel comply with project procedures, safety program requirements, work rules, etc.
11. Document all violations, notify project management, recommend/implement corrective actions as required.
Qualifications:
1. 5+ years of experience in the construction industry, specifically in a supervisory role.
2. Proven track record of successfully completed commercial construction projects.
3. Strong knowledge of construction processes, equipment, and OSHA guidelines.
4. Ability to read blueprints, structural drawings, and plan sets.
5. Advanced understanding of risk management policies and procedures.
6. Extensive experience managing budgets for large construction projects.
7. Strong knowledge of construction materials, processes, and equipment.
8. Must have OSHA 30 certification.
9. Ability to travel as required for the job.
10. Exceptional leadership, organizational, and communication skills.
11. A strong work ethic and a professional demeanor.
